Sodium bicarbonate and the natural mineral borax each have a high pH that inhibits the growth and survival of mold. Both products are inexpensive and easy to use. Make a paste of the powders with a few drops of water and apply it to the areas of mold growth.

Put undiluted white distilled vinegar in a spray bottle. Spray the moldy area and allow to sit for one hour. Scrub off the mold with a soft-bristled brush. Rinse with a damp rag and then pat dry. Mar 5, 2024 · Mold growing outdoors on firewood. Molds come in many colors; both white and black molds are shown here. Molds are part of the natural environment. Outdoors, molds play a part in nature by breaking down dead organic matter such as fallen leaves and dead trees, but indoors, mold growth should be avoided. Say goodbye to mold and hello to a healthier home. Mold. Mold can cause many health effects. For some people, mold can cause a stuffy nose, sore throat, coughing or wheezing, burning eyes, or skin rash. People with asthma or who are allergic to mold may have severe reactions. Immune-compromised people and people with chronic lung disease may get infections in their lungs from mold.

Then spray again, let it sit for 10 minutes, wipe (with a different side of your rag or towel to avoid re-contamination), then rinse and dry the wall.Borax, a white mineral powder, is a natural way to clean mold in the bathroom. Mix one cup borax with one gallon warm water. Pour some of the solution into a spray bottle. Spray directly onto the surface you want to clean. Mold on drywall is usually the result of water damage. With mold eating away at the paper lining of the drywall and water eroding the gypsum underneath, your wall or ceiling will grow weaker and weaker.
